RosterElf Logo
Start trial
ONLINE LEAVE MANAGEMENT SYSTEM

Leave management software made easy

RosterElf leave management interface showing annual leave request
  • Request & approve leave

  • Avoid roster errors due to leave

  • Record sick leave instantly

  • Quickly find replacements for absent staff

Start trial Book a demo
No credit card required
4.8 stars, 1,570 ratings

Best-rated rostering & HR software on Xero and Google

VERIFIED RATINGS

Trusted by 30,000+ workplaces

4.7+ average

Rated on Xero · Google · G2 · Capterra

HOW IT WORKS

Easy employee leave requests and manager approvals

RosterElf simplifies leave management with digital workflows that replace paper forms and manual tracking. Employees request leave from their phone, managers approve instantly.

Request leave

Employees submit time-off requests via the mobile app. One tap submission for annual, sick, personal, or any custom leave type.

Manager approval

Managers receive instant notifications and approve or decline requests from anywhere. No more chasing paperwork.

Roster updates

Approved leave automatically updates rosters in real time, preventing scheduling conflicts and double-bookings.

LEAVE MANAGEMENT

Easy employee leave requests and manager approvals

RosterElf leave request approval interface
MOBILE-FIRST

Request and approve leave in seconds

Stop chasing emails, texts, or scraps of paper for time-off requests.

With RosterElf, employees submit leave straight from their phone in just a few taps, and managers can approve instantly from anywhere.

No delays, no missed messages, and no confusion. Every update flows automatically through to rosters in real time, preventing clashes before they happen and giving managers full visibility over staffing levels. One tap, zero stress, total clarity—and a smoother experience for both staff and management.

COMPLIANCE BUILT-IN

Accurate leave balances and payroll-ready syncing

Leave balance syncing with Xero and MYOB
FAIR WORK FRIENDLY

Payroll and leave always in sync

RosterElf tracks employee leave directly against the correct award rules and automatically syncs balances with both Xero and MYOB.

Every entitlement is calculated in line with legislation, giving staff confidence they're seeing the right information and ensuring managers always work with accurate, up-to-date data.

With this smooth flow into payroll, wages are processed without unexpected adjustments or disputes, and managers save hours previously lost to manual reconciliation. Compliance is built in, mistakes are avoided, and your business saves time while staying Fair Work–ready, ensuring peace of mind for owners and accuracy for staff.

EMPLOYEE EXPERIENCE

Help staff with transparent leave balances

Leave requests pending approval interface
SELF-SERVICE

Put staff in control of their own time

Employees can easily check their leave balances, request time off, and track approvals directly in the app—without the frustration of chasing managers or filling out paperwork.

Updates flow through instantly, making processes more transparent and ensuring every roster stays fair and accurate.

The result is less admin for you, more confidence for your staff, and happier, more engaged teams all round.

SMART SCHEDULING

Rosters that adapt automatically to leave

RosterElf roster showing employee unavailable status
PERFECT MATCH

Rosters that never clash with time off

Stop chasing emails, texts, or scraps of paper for time-off requests.

With RosterElf, employees submit leave straight from their phone in just a few taps, and managers can approve instantly from anywhere.

No delays, no missed messages, and no confusion. Every update flows automatically through to rosters in real time, preventing clashes before they happen and giving managers full visibility over staffing levels. One tap, zero stress, total clarity—and a smoother experience for both staff and management.

KEY BENEFITS

Why your business needs leave management software

Simplified leave requests

Digital submission reduces administrative burden. No more paper forms or email chains.

Real-time tracking

Monitor leave balances, requests, and approvals in real time. Always know where you stand.

Automated approvals

Simplified workflows reduce delays. Managers approve with one tap from anywhere.

Enhanced accuracy

Automated calculations minimise errors. Leave balances are always correct.

Improved compliance

All leave data organised and accessible. Ready for audits and Fair Work requirements.

Smooth integration

Connects with Xero, MYOB, and your existing HR systems. One source of truth.

SEAMLESS INTEGRATION

Leave management connected to your workflow

Leave data flows automatically into rostering, payroll, and HR — ensuring consistency and eliminating duplicate data entry.

WHAT IT MEANS

What is leave management software?

Leave management software is a digital platform that automates employee time-off requests, approvals, and balance tracking. It replaces paper forms and spreadsheets with mobile-friendly workflows, ensuring leave is accurately recorded, rosters are automatically updated, and payroll integration happens smoothly. This reduces administrative burden, prevents scheduling conflicts, and keeps your business compliant with workplace laws.

RELATED FEATURES

Explore related features

Discover other RosterElf features that work great together

View all features
FAQ

Frequently asked questions

  • Employees request leave through the RosterElf web app or mobile app by selecting dates, choosing leave type (annual, sick, unpaid, etc.), and adding optional notes. Managers receive instant notifications and can approve or decline with one click. Learn the employee leave request process. Request leave from browser → | Request from mobile →
  • When employees submit leave requests, managers receive email and in-app notifications. Review requests in the dashboard, check roster impact and leave balances, then approve or decline with an optional message to the employee. The process takes seconds per request. Action leave requests →
  • Yes, managers can create, edit, or delete leave entries for staff members—useful for processing backdated leave, correcting errors, or entering leave for employees who don't have app access. All leave entries sync with rosters and payroll automatically. Manage leave on behalf of staff →
  • Approved leave entries export to your payroll system (Xero, MYOB, etc.) alongside regular timesheets. Leave is automatically coded by type (annual, sick, etc.) and deducted from employee balances. Learn how to process leave through to payroll. Process leave for payroll →
  • Yes, staff can set their ongoing availability (which days/times they can work) and mark specific dates as unavailable. This helps managers create rosters that respect employee preferences and prevents scheduling conflicts. Update availability →

Start your free 15 day RosterElf trial today

Join 30,000+ Australian businesses using RosterElf to simplify leave management.

Start trial Book a demo
4.8 stars by 1,570 users
100+ countries 30,000+ users